Background: The implementation of the independent curriculum in modern education is a breakthrough aimed at improving the quality of education in Indonesia. This curriculum is expected to enhance students' quality in various areas, one of which is the development of critical thinking skills in early childhood.Aim: This research aims to determine the effect of the discovery learning model using loose parts media on the critical thinking skills of early childhood.Method: This quantitative research involves 5-6-year-old students at Pos Paud Tanjung as the sample. Data collection was conducted through observation using a one-group pretest-posttest research design. The data analysis technique employed statistical testing using the T-test.Results: The results of the data analysis indicate that there is an effect of the discovery learning model using loose parts media on the critical thinking skills of early childhood, as evidenced by a significance result of 0,01 < 0,05 and a negative t-value of -15,657 < -2,10982. The average critical thinking skills score of the children before the treatment was 5,77.Conclusion: Thus, these findings contribute to the understanding of the potential application of the discovery learning model using loose parts-based media in enhancing the critical thinking skills of early childhood.
